Falsifying Documents: Forged Legal Documents - LegalMatch Law Library

WebOct 16, 2024 · The criminal offense of forgery consists of creating or changing something with the intent of passing it off as genuine, usually for financial gain or to gain something else of value. This often involves creation of false financial instruments, such as checks, or official documents.
